slf4j与log4j slf4j是通用的接口规范,log4j是具体实现的日志插件,slf4j也可以搭配其他实现的jar包一起使用。 本文参考3W学习方法来叙述内容。 一、What 1、slf4j和log4j的区别是什么? log4j:log for java,...
log4j2相信大家非常常见了,以前基本去了项目每个都有,然后也都直接用,很少有时间研究过它,这不这两天稍微空了点,学习了下,然后写下了这篇文章记录。
标签: xml
DOCTYPE log4j:configuration SYSTEM "log4j.dtd"> <log4j:configuration> <!-- 将日志信息输出到控制台 --> <appender name="ConsoleAppender" class="org.apache.log4j.ConsoleAppender">...
(img-QO8IEM08-1713376721682)],可以添加V获取:vip204888 (备注网络安全)**
1、获取。
SpringBoot配置日志(log4j版) 介绍 在软件开发中,日志是个很重要的东西,它记录系统中方法运行的过程信息和系统报错时的错误信息。开发人员在排查系统中的错误,就可以通过错误日志来进行排查,如果没有日志那排查...
Root节点用来指定项目的根日志,如果没有单独指定Logger,那么就会默认使用该Root日志输出。Logger节点用来单独指定日志的形式,比如要为指定包下的class指定不同的日志级别等。
当满足条件(日志大小、指定时间等)重命名或打包原日志文件进行归档,生成新日志文件用于日志写入。设置后,假如10点的日志开始重启服务,则从11点触发一次rollover操作,生成。设置后,假如10点的日志开始重启服务...
一、Log4j简介 Log4j有三个主要的组件: Loggers(记录器):日志类别和级别 Appenders(输出目标):日志要输出到的地方 Layouts(布局):日志以何种形式输出 1.1 Loggers Loggers组件在此系统中被分为五个...
否则目标文件将在每次滚动时被覆盖,因为基于大小的触发策略不会导致文件名中的时间戳值更改。触发一次rollover操作{[0-3),[3-6),[6-9),[9-12)},生成。1、不与基于时间的触发策略结合使用时,基于大小的触发策略将...
是一种布局策略(Layout),用于定义日志消息的输出格式。
相信很多程序猿朋友对log4j都很熟悉,log4j可以说是陪伴了绝大多数的朋友开启的编程。我不知道log4j之前是用什么,至少在我的生涯中,是log4j带我开启的日志时代。log4j是Apache的一个开源项目,我们不去考究它的...
原日志文件进行归档,生成新日志文件用于日志写入。当满足条件(日志大小、指定时间等)
个人理解就是定义的xml里的。,一处定义多处使用。
log4j配置详解(非常详细) Log4J的配置文件(Configuration File)就是用来设置记录器的级别、存放器和布局的,它可接key=value格式的设置或xml格式的设置信息。通过配置,可以创建出Log4J的运行环境。 配置文件 Log4J...
标签: log4j
log4j支持将日志输出到不同的目的地,例如控制台、文件、数据库等。在项目的classpath下创建log4j.properties文件,配置日志输出的级别、输出目的地、输出格式等信息。其中,Logger.getLogger()方法的参数为当前类的...